Output 81247a3b603c468d31721376187557cba94f1cfb64b768f118f87bf0890fcd80:1

value
591674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 302708339fde81bfafe0d5cd3985975326ff7552 OP_EQUALVERIFY OP_CHECKSIG
address
15PcCCgToNG6mym5oxk8Qge9AWf9ceLWEs
transaction
81247a3b603c468d31721376187557cba94f1cfb64b768f118f87bf0890fcd80
confirmations
267563
spent
true